Hi Dok Can i use gpu0123 with normalv7 and gpu456 with heavy? need run two copy of miner? or add in config two section for different algo? use 1.6.6 now
If you want to do algo switching then you must do it in config files, if you want to mine 'normally' you can do it either way. SRBMiner-CN.exe --ccryptonighttype normalv7 --cgpuid 0,1,2,3 --cgpuintensity 0,0,0,0 --cgputhreads 2,2,2,2 --cpool POOL --cwallet WALLET --cpassword x --sendallstales SRBMiner-CN.exe --ccryptonighttype heavy --cgpuid 4,5,6 --cgpuintensity 0,0,0 --cgputhreads 2,2,2 --cpool POOL --cwallet WALLET --cpassword x --sendallstales

I've got a question about the reboot script when using pool switching: do you have to set it for each algo separately or can you just add it at the end of the start.bat command line?
...Doc? reboot script is the one you add in config.txt, so yes, add it in every config. That is handy because maybe your heavy algo clock settings in overdriventool are not the same as for v7, so on every algo start it will run the appropriate batch file.

Here's a nice little tip on how to increase your hashrate even more : Example for Vega56 doing normalv7 algo : 1.Put --enableduplicategpuid in start.bat at the end of line ( SRBMiner-CN.exe --config config-normalv7.txt --pools pools-normalv7.txt --sendallstales --enableduplicategpuid ) 2.Set gpu in config-normalv7.txt : { "cryptonight_type" : "normalv7", "intensity" : 0, "double_threads" : true, "gpu_conf" : [ { "id" : 0, "intensity" : 122, "worksize" : 8, "threads" : 1 }, { "id" : 0, "intensity" : 124, "worksize" : 8, "threads" : 1 } ] }
What was done here? When using 2 threads , the best value for intensity is 123. By enabling the usage of duplicate gpu id, you make 2 separate threads for 1 gpu, but one has value 123-1, the other 123+1. This method can be used on any GPU, you just need to experiment with the intensities.

Do i have to setup a own config file for xtl tu use Algo switch?
every algo you plan to use needs to have its own config file, because for example you use intensity 56 for heavy, but its not 56 for xtl. Understood 5 supported algos - 5 configs that's right. Its better this way because you can set everything separately for every algo, like min_rig_speed, reboot_script etc how about pools ? do i need make separated pools ? or just change on algos.txt pools" : "pools-algoswitch.txt", to pools" : "pools-normalv7.txt",At the moment only Monero Ocean is the only pool supporting this so you can set it in pools-algoswitch.txt : { "pools" : [ {"pool" : "gulf.moneroocean.stream:10016", "wallet" : "your-xmr-wallet", "password" : "x"}, {"pool" : "de.moneroocean.stream:10016", "wallet" : "your-xmr-wallet", "password" : "x"}, ] } then in algos.txt set on every algo the pool to pools-algoswitch.txt. So you made only 1 pool file.
